Woman suffers cardiac arrest at apartment near NW 16th St, Lawton OK
A 53-year-old woman at an apartment near Northwest 16th Street experienced cardiac arrest. She was initially conscious and breathing but became unresponsive and stopped breathing. CPR was started on her at the scene.
